airway manikins are essential tools in medical training for healthcare professionals. These manikins are specifically designed to simulate the human airway, allowing medical students and practitioners to practice airway management techniques in a controlled environment. From basic airway maintenance to advanced procedures such as intubation and suctioning, airway manikins provide a realistic and valuable training experience.

One of the key benefits of using airway manikins is the ability to simulate a variety of airway scenarios. These manikins are equipped with interchangeable airway parts that can be adjusted to mimic different degrees of airway obstructions or abnormalities. This allows students to practice managing different airway challenges, such as performing the Heimlich maneuver or clearing the airway of a foreign object. By exposing students to a wide range of simulated scenarios, airway manikins help to build their confidence and competency in handling real-life emergencies.

In addition to simulating airway obstructions, airway manikins can also replicate the anatomical features of the human airway. This includes structures such as the epiglottis, vocal cords, and trachea, which are essential for procedures like intubation and ventilation. By practicing on airway manikins, students can familiarize themselves with the anatomy of the airway and develop the necessary skills to perform procedures accurately and safely. This hands-on experience is invaluable for building muscle memory and improving procedural proficiency.

Furthermore, airway manikins are equipped with advanced features that provide real-time feedback on performance. Some models come with sensors and monitors that can detect the depth and rate of chest compressions, the effectiveness of ventilation, and the success of intubation attempts. This feedback allows students to assess their techniques and make adjustments to improve their skills. By receiving immediate feedback on their performance, students can identify areas of weakness and work towards mastering the necessary skills for airway management.
